用mysql创建视图view_user,用于显示用户和金额,要求视图各列为中午列名,并查看视图数据
时间: 2024-05-10 14:14:37 浏览: 80
可以按照以下的SQL语句来创建视图view_user,并查看视图数据:
```
--创建视图view_user
CREATE VIEW view_user AS
SELECT 用户名, 金额 FROM 用户表;
--查看视图数据
SELECT * FROM view_user;
```
其中,`用户名`和`金额`是视图中的列名,需要根据实际情况进行修改。最后的`SELECT`语句可以用来查看视图数据。
相关问题
mysql,使用视图view_user添加:张洁 544 李佳 878,并查看视图显示数据
假设视图view_user是基于user表创建的,其中包含了字段name和id,可以通过以下步骤添加张洁和李佳,并查看视图显示数据:
1. 添加数据:
```
INSERT INTO user (name, id) VALUES ('张洁', 544), ('李佳', 878);
```
2. 创建视图:
```
CREATE VIEW view_user AS SELECT name, id FROM user;
```
3. 查看视图数据:
```
SELECT * FROM view_user;
```
执行以上步骤后,应该能够看到视图中包含了张洁和李佳的数据。
laravel mysql 视图_Laravel 视图的创建和数据传递
在 Laravel 中,你可以通过使用 `create` 命令来创建一个视图。例如,如果你需要创建一个名为 `welcome` 的视图,可以在终端中运行以下命令:
```
php artisan make:view welcome
```
这将在 `resources/views` 目录下创建一个名为 `welcome.blade.php` 的视图文件。
要在视图中传递数据,你需要在控制器中使用 `view` 函数。例如,如果你需要将名为 `John` 的用户传递到 `welcome` 视图中,可以在控制器中使用以下代码:
```
public function welcome()
{
$user = 'John';
return view('welcome', ['user' => $user]);
}
```
在这里,我们将 `$user` 变量传递给 `welcome` 视图,并使用 `['user' => $user]` 数组将其命名为 `user`。
在视图中,你可以使用 `{{ $user }}` 语法来输出传递的数据。例如,在 `welcome.blade.php` 中,你可以使用以下代码来输出用户的姓名:
```
Welcome, {{ $user }}!
```
当你在浏览器中访问 `welcome` 路由时,将看到以下输出:
```
Welcome, John!
```
这就是 Laravel 中创建视图和传递数据的基础。
阅读全文